Lancaster Roman Cavalry Stone
Discover the captivating history behind the Lancaster Roman Cavalry Stone, authored by Stephen Bull and published by Carnegie Publishing Ltd in 2008. This engaging illustrated volume, spanning 64 pages, delves into the remarkable find made in November 2005 in Lancashire—a massive stone depicting a triumphant horseman alongside his fallen adversary. Through meticulous research, Bull seeks to unravel the intriguing mysteries surrounding Insus, son of Vodullus, providing readers with a deeper understanding of Roman history in England.
